Hezbollah leader Naim Qassem has praised the newly announced memorandum of understanding between the United States and Iran, describing it as a decisive moment that could facilitate the removal of Israeli forces from Lebanon.

Key points

  • Naim Qassem stated that the agreement includes provisions for a ceasefire on all fronts, including the Lebanese front.
  • Hezbollah continues to reject direct participation in ongoing negotiations between Lebanon and Israel, which are mediated by the United States.
  • The group maintains that discussions should focus on mutual security rather than any project involving the disarmament of the organization.

Why it matters

The inclusion of Lebanon in the US-Iran memorandum signals a potential shift in regional security dynamics and the operational status of Hezbollah in the ongoing conflict.
